The journey began at Rancho Del Rio, a picturesque spot that seemed to be a gateway to another world. The river stretched out before me, flanked by meadows, valleys, and the imposing canyon walls. Our guide, a friendly and knowledgeable soul, introduced us to the inflatable kayaks, affectionately known as “duckies.” These sit-on-top style kayaks promised a personal connection with the river, allowing us to navigate our own paths while following the guide’s lead.
As we set off, the river’s gentle current carried us through a landscape that seemed untouched by time. The occasional sight of a bald eagle soaring overhead or a deer grazing by the riverbank added to the magic of the experience. The Thrill of the Rapids
While the Upper Colorado River is known for its mild Class I-II rapids, the occasional Class III rapids at higher water flow added an exhilarating twist to the journey. As someone who thrives on the thrill of water sports, the prospect of navigating these rapids was both exciting and a little daunting.
Our guide expertly led us through the rapids, offering tips and encouragement along the way. The rush of the water, the spray on my face, and the adrenaline coursing through my veins created a symphony of sensations that was both thrilling and invigorating. It was a dance with the river, a test of skill and courage, and a reminder of the power and beauty of nature.
For those who prefer a more leisurely pace, the river offers stretches of slow-moving water perfect for soaking in the scenery and enjoying the tranquility. Whether you’re a seasoned kayaker or a first-timer, the Upper Colorado River has something for everyone, making it an ideal destination for families and adventure seekers alike.
